comparemela.com
Home
Japan Up Garage
Top Japan Up Garage | Reviews & Ratings | comparemela.com
Japan up garage in Japan - 9042235/ near uruma-shi
1.UP Garage 沖縄中部店, Uruma Shi, Okinawa, Japan